As enterprises race deeper into cloud-first, identity-centric, hyperconnected environments, traditional security operations have hit a breaking point. The old model – detect in one tool, investigate in another, respond somewhere else – has collapsed under the weight of scale, complexity, and attacker automation. In this new reality, Threat Detection, Investigation, and Response (TDIR) has emerged not as a “feature,” but as the core operating system for the modern SOC.
